Understanding ADHD
ADHD is defined by symptoms such as neg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. It can affect different elements of life, including academic efficiency, expert development, and interpersonal relationships. While many individuals get a diagnosis throughout youth, adults are progressively acknowledging signs that might have been overlooked or misattributed during their youth.

Private Assessment Process
The private ADHD assessment process usually involves a number of phases:
Initial Consultation: This conference assesses the person's issues and describes the assessment procedure.
Diagnostic Interviews: Comprehensive interviews can involve family history, school reports, and the person's experiences.
Standardized Testing: Cognitive and neuropsychological tests might be employed to assess the extent of ADHD symptoms.
Feedback Session: After assessment, a follow-up session talks about findings and prospective treatment choices.
Treatment Planning: Collaboration with healthcare suppliers to develop tailored techniques for managing ADHD symptoms effectively.

Q1: How long does the assessment procedure take?The total assessment procedure can take anywhere from a few weeks to a number of months depending on the clinic's accessibility and the person's schedule.
Q2: Will my assessment results be kept confidential?Yes, private clinics are usually needed to follow rigorous privacy protocols to protect your individual info. Q3: Can adults be diagnosed with ADHD?Yes, individuals of any age
can be identified with ADHD,
and adults often seek assessment due to difficulties they deal with in their work or individual lives. Q4: Is medication required after diagnosis?Not always. Each individual will have a personalizedtreatment strategy, which may include behavioral therapy, way of life changes, or medication, depending on their preferences and needs. Q5: How can I find a trustworthy private ADHD clinic?Research clinics online, read reviews, and talk to health experts or local support system for recommendations to guarantee you choose a reputable service supplier.
